How to Climb the Ladder in Tech

syevale111

New Member
The tech industry is dynamic and competitive, offering immense opportunities for career growth. Whether you're a newcomer or looking to advance to senior roles, a strategic approach can help you climb the ladder. Here's how you can achieve success in the tech world: Full Stack Training in Pune

1. Set Clear Career Goals
Define your short-term and long-term goals.

  • Short-Term: Acquire certifications, master a programming language, or complete a project.
  • Long-Term: Aspire for roles like Tech Lead, Solutions Architect, or CTO.
    Tip: Break your goals into actionable steps and track your progress regularly.
2. Continuously Learn and Upskill
Tech evolves rapidly—staying current is essential.

  • Key Areas to Focus On:
    • New programming languages or frameworks.
    • Emerging technologies like AI, blockchain, and cloud computing.
    • Soft skills such as leadership, communication, and time management.
  • Learning Resources:
    • Online platforms like Coursera, Udemy, and Pluralsight.
    • Participate in hackathons, webinars, and coding bootcamps.
3. Build a Strong Portfolio
Your portfolio showcases your expertise and problem-solving skills.

  • What to Include:
    • Projects demonstrating diverse skills (frontend, backend, data analysis).
    • Contributions to open-source projects.
    • Case studies highlighting challenges, solutions, and results.
  • Pro Tip: Host your portfolio on GitHub and deploy projects on platforms like AWS, Vercel, or Heroku.
4. Network Strategically
Building relationships can open doors to new opportunities.

  • Ways to Network:
    • Attend industry conferences, meetups, and tech talks.
    • Join online communities on LinkedIn, Discord, or Reddit.
    • Connect with mentors or colleagues in your desired field.
  • Tip: Be genuine and offer value—networking is a two-way street. Full Stack Course in Pune
5. Seek Feedback and Mentorship
Feedback helps you improve, and mentors guide you through challenges.

  • How to Seek Feedback:
    • Regularly request code reviews from peers or managers.
    • Ask for performance feedback during one-on-ones.
  • Finding a Mentor:
    • Approach senior colleagues or industry professionals.
    • Join mentorship programs or communities like ADPList.
6. Specialize, Then Diversify
Master a niche skill before branching out into related areas.

  • Specialization Examples:
    • Mastering Full Stack Development or a specific framework like React or Django.
    • Becoming an expert in cloud platforms like AWS or Azure.
  • Diversification Examples:
    • Learning complementary skills like DevOps, data visualization, or cybersecurity.
7. Take Ownership of Projects
Demonstrate initiative and leadership.

  • Volunteer for challenging tasks or small lead projects.
  • Showcase problem-solving skills and a results-oriented mindset.
    Pro Tip: Document and present your contributions in team meetings or on your resume.
 
Сверху